Output 185b939d6cd9c7b08c1c6cb045cae0afaaf443abcd8b49fba45cb97bbe982f84:1

value
4965971554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b5c5ae77ace14fc849a700956e8797892aa85bc OP_EQUAL
address
3CwHg5nh8q9ZZFKYwik67mQfCXViKrcqyU
transaction
185b939d6cd9c7b08c1c6cb045cae0afaaf443abcd8b49fba45cb97bbe982f84
confirmations
474321
spent
true